  • the present specification refers to improvements introduced in the accident prevention systems in motor vehicles, of which they are mounted in motor vehicles to collaborate in the prevention of accidents with such vehicles, which provide essential characteristics of novelty and notable advantages with with respect to similar means known in the current State of the Art and intended for the same purpose.
  • the invention advocates a set of improvements or improvements in those systems that are automatically operable, to automatically notify the carrier driver of such a system that an abnormal situation has occurred due to the driver's own behavior. , as may be the result of fatigue, sleep or any other circumstance that distracts the driver and causes a decrease or loss of pressure exerted by the driver's hands on the steering wheel of the motor vehicle.
  • the invention provides for the use of some elements that are already installed in the vehicle, such as lights or horn.
  • the invention also contemplates the optional possibility of incorporating the system in collaboration with the tachometer conventionally installed in passenger or freight transport vehicles.
  • This invention has its application within the industry dedicated both to the manufacture of automobiles, and to the manufacture of its parts and accessories.
  • Some devices known to be installed in a motor vehicle are known in the market, intended to make warnings to the driver of such a motor vehicle, both optical and acoustic, when due to the effect of sleepiness or fatigue, the driver relaxes, being able to even falling asleep in fact in many practical situations, thus causing an accident in which not only the vehicle itself may be involved, but often affects other vehicles that normally circulate.
  • the invention is designed to be incorporated in any type of motor vehicle, but preferably in tourist vehicles.
  • this electronic module could be incorporated in a freight transport vehicle, or in a passenger collective transport vehicle, allowing its performance as an element or system capable of generating alarms when the driver presents some anomaly in the driving, but at the same time, according to the characteristics dictated in terms of transport on vehicles whose mission is the transport of goods or passengers, to be able to incorporate the same in connection with the tachometer required by law to this type of vehicles, consequently acting as an alarm device, in the specific case that the ducts of the vehicle for transporting goods or passengers, does not comply with the rules which conventionally establishes and measures the tachometer in question.
  • a handwheel also divided into two sections, is provided with a first section fixed to the central steering actuator and a second section movable between certain limits with respect to the first, between which the invention establishes certain fixing and retention means located, with preference, in four or six predetermined positions, evenly distributed along the length of the steering wheel, and such means consisting of pairs of support pieces, conveniently separated from each other, constituted in a "U" shape with both branches configured superiorly as of tabs directed outwards, with bevelled leading edge, and these pieces having a cylindrical elevation of less height than the respective branches and occupying a central position.
  • Each of these cylindrical elevations is intended to receive and retain one end of a spring that works with pressure.
  • the mobile section of the steering wheel incorporates pairs of reception pieces, generally preferably prismatic, in positions correspondingly coinciding with the couples of the fixed section, and so that said prismatic pieces include adventures adapted for the reception and retention of the tabs of the pairs of pieces of the fixed section.
  • Each of these pieces also has a central cylindrical elevation, intended to receive and retain the opposite end of each respective spring, also appearing between the pieces of each pair, and in a approximately centered position a cylindrical projection, of greater diameter than the above mentioned and of predetermined height, constitutive of the other terminal necessary to close / open the electrical control circuit of the system.
  • control means are constituted by an electronic means with which the connection of the vehicle's own warning means is determined, such as the existing lights and horn.
  • the control system is electrically connected, preferably to a daytime activation switch, as well as to the ignition switch itself of the vehicle status lights for automatic activation at night.
  • the electronic control module is electrically connected to the light and horn control systems provided in the vehicle.
  • the electronic module used will preferably consist of a module of the type of detection alarm of those known in the market, and such that it will preferably incorporate a timed relay of minimum actuation, which will remain activated for a period of time, preferably two minutes, regardless of whether the driver deactivates both the day and night systems.
  • the electronic module will conventionally incorporate pulse relays for sending the received signal to the actuator part of the warning means.
  • the electronic control module will be electrically powered from the battery of the vehicle in which it is installed, and protected by a fuse of suitable value.

Abstract

Il s'agit d'une fixation entre une section fixe (15) et une section mobile (20) du volant pour l'activation d'un module de contrôle (1) mettant en marche les lumières (45) et le klaxon (46) du véhicule. A cet effect, deux pièces (16) et (16') sont disposées en 'U' dans une section du volant, avec les bords supérieurs formant des languettes de rétention, munies d'élévations cylindriques centrales destinées à retenir l'extrémité d'un ressort (18) et (18') et d'une saillie intermédiaire (19) qui fait office de borne de connexion. Sur l'autre section sont placées des pièces prismatiques (21) et (21'), dotées d'un emplacement pour les languettes de rétention susmentionnées, d'une élévation (23) et (23') pour retenir l'autre extrémité de chaque ressort (18) et (18') et d'une saillie (24) intermédiaire de la borne complémentaire à celle déjà mentionnée (19). Ce dispositif peut être installé dans les véhicules de transport de passagers et de marchandises en collaboration avec le tachymètre (40).
